Fighting Stress Through Exercise
Stress appears to be something that a lot of people face in their daily lives. There are so many events that can spark off its effects and some of these can be long-term. The kinds of problems are diverse including issues about finance and marriages. Homes and working environments may be where other people can have an impact on you. Your mind and body can both suffer due to this unless you help yourself to overturn the grip stress has on you. Physical exercise can be good in the fight against stress and this is an area we will now study.

If you have experienced that uncomfortable problem of having thoughts racing through your head, then you can get relief through working out.
In terms of what you might want to do if working out, it needs to be something you will not find boring or taxing. You should look forward to it as opposed to it becoming another thing that causes you stress. Taking action is crucial and you can do this as soon as you have made some decisions regarding what is most effective for you. The location of what you do is down to you whether it be a gym or playing fields for a particular sport. Relaxing is made more painless when other individuals are involved so anything of that nature could be helpful.
In terms of the impact on you generally, not only will you find that stress will have less effect but you will build your self-confidence through daily exercise. Anxiety starts to disappear as with a toned body you begin seeing yourself in a new way. If you can set some goals with your activities, this can also help as your mind will begin to focus on other things even when you are not actually working out. The events that trigger stress can have less impact as you develop inner strength from reaching the goals you have set.

You may observe a nearly euphoric feeling when you have just stopped exercising and with this comes optimism. This can give you self-confidence if you are starting to experience stress, particularly if you make a conscious decision to ground yourself to that feeling when you have it.
Stress can have a terrible effect on your life if you allow it and by exercising you can regain control of your mental wellbeing.
